API  96134 Tie Rod End

API 96134 Tie Rod End

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

46A0677A

ACDELCO 46A0677A Tie Rod End

1015244

BECK/ARNLEY 1015244 Tie Rod End

2525601

LEMFORDER 2525601 Tie Rod End

HRA5070

HOWARD ROBERTS HRA5070 Tie Rod End

21849

FEBI 21849 Tie Rod End

73959

API 73959 Tie Rod End

45A2230

ACDELCO 45A2230 Tie Rod End

MIES0176

Airtex MIES0176 Tie Rod End

3667601

LEMFORDER 3667601 Tie Rod End

MES3048RL

MEVOTECH MES3048RL Tie Rod End

HRA2640

HOWARD ROBERTS HRA2640 Tie Rod End

HRA3175

HOWARD ROBERTS HRA3175 Tie Rod End